In a move that is not surprising to anyone, Activision have announced that Crash Bandicoot 4: It’s About Time is coming to Switch and PC, as well as getting actual next gen versions of the game as well.

The Switch version of the game is coming on March 12, the PC version is coming later in the year, while the trailer above was more about the game hitting new platforms, the one below is for the Switch and you can see that the game looks really good on the portable platform.

March 12 will also be the day that the next gen versions of the game release, if you own the game now on PlayStation 4 or Xbox One, you will get a free next-gen upgrade, within the same console family, to the PlayStation 5 or Xbox Series X|S.

Those who get the next-gen versions can look forward to 4K visuals running at 60fps. Additionally, players will also enjoy quicker loading times to dive into the wumpa-eating action and 3D audio that will immerse them in all-new dimensions.

PlayStation 5 owners in particular will be in for an extra treat with DualSense wireless controllers bringing adaptive triggers to players’ fingertips. Fans will now be able to feel the force of Neo Cortex’s DNA-changing blaster and experience the grip as they grapple with Tawna’s Hookshot. Additionally, PlayStation 5’s Activity Card feature will give players a clear breakdown of their progress throughout each of the game’s dimensions, providing guidance to achieve objectives and more.
